Postby Viper » August 5th, 2025, 8:24 pm

Welcome aboard.

So I suspect what you're saying is that once the anchor is up it sits in such a way that you have to give it a push for it to launch, am I reading that right? If so, sometimes a longer anchor helps or a different style all together. There are also roller assemblies that have a forward pivoting section. Once the tension is released on the chain, the assembly pivots down.
